With the Olympics looming ever closer, understandably security will be a main concern for the London 2012 organizing committee. It looks as though they are on top of things in this respect, having carried out a security test in Scotland recently. The rehearsal took place at the semi-final of the Scottish Communities League Cup between Ayr and Kilmarnock, which the latter won in extra time, and involved fans.

The future of the Women's Professional Soccer league (WPS) has been thrown into doubt yet again after the termination of the majicJacks franchise. The WPS, which comprised six teams prior to the 'Jacks expulsion, was already operating under a one year waiver of the US Soccer rule that a league must have a minimum of eight teams to be recognised.

Understandably, European nations often decline to participate in Olympic football competition. The alignment of their respective four year rotations means that UEFA's European Championships coincide with the Olympic Games.
